Transaction 5c9fdc314fb5cbcb6f780d7dae89df075d30ecc67d9bb1e250a85dff70ce38de
1 Input
1 Output
-
5c9fdc314fb5cbcb6f780d7dae89df075d30ecc67d9bb1e250a85dff70ce38de:0
- value
- 2531043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6ffaac12dda6b6a15312896a9575ab7ffc3b714 OP_EQUAL
- address
- 3KqDzagKELeQmT7bF5ejxFpWNMnkunS3PP